The Two Higgs Doublet Model and LHC Results

Presented by Dr. Pedro FERREIRA
Type: Higgs Phenomenology
Track: Higgs Phenomenology

Content

The Two Higgs Doublet Model (2HDM) is one of the simplest extensions of the Standard Model (SM). The discovery of the Higgs boson at the LHC, and the fact that its properties seem to follow what is expected within the SM, puts constrainst of the 2HDM. We will review those constraints and show that there is still a great deal of parameter space left where extra scalars may dwell.
